A CMS or Content Management System allows YOU to manage your website from a user-friendly interface vs a code editor and file system viewer or a combination of even MORE tools.
A CMS will have a catalog of themes, add-ons, the pages nicely organized and most of these things will originate from 1 interface that connects to your domain & web hosting account. A Static website will be scattered in different files and folders leading to a main directory which ideally connects to your hosting server.

A Static website would require that the viewer and editor of those files know html5, css3, javascript, some photoshop and possibly some java. There are programs available that make Static website a little easier but nowhere in comparison to building a website on a CMS.
With a Static website you literally write code and transfer it to some organized file system on a web server that you must configure.

Not all CMS’ are equal but assuming the advantages of simplicity, speed of being able to edit and make changes, variety of plugins for ultra-enhanced functionality, sociability and marketability through the use of content marketing, PPC and SEO – then a CMS is undoubtedly the best choice.
Most our clients tend to be business owners 1st, not necessarily website coders and want to focus on growing the business more than maintaining a web design and development team to run their custom coded website.

Changing CMS’ for the future?
Changing from CMS to CMS is not always easy. Migration, as we call it, can be even more complicated than starting a new website because many things can be overlooked. Tread lightly and get educated
